Job description
Overview

Are you passionate about aviation and skilled in procurement? Join our dynamic team as a Materials Buyer, where you\'ll play a critical role in supporting aircraft maintenance, repair, and operations (MRO) through strategic sourcing and supply chain excellence.

Responsibilities
  • Procure aircraft parts, materials, and consumables from approved suppliers.
  • Ensure compliance with aviation regulations (EASA, FAA) and internal quality standards.
  • Negotiate pricing, delivery terms, and supplier contracts to optimize cost and performance.
  • Monitor inventory levels and coordinate with stores to maintain optimal stock.
  • Collaborate with engineering, maintenance, and logistics teams to meet material needs.
  • Track and expedite orders to meet operational deadlines.
  • Maintain accurate records of purchases, certifications, and supplier performance.
  • Support audits and inspections with full documentation and traceability.
  • Identify and onboard new suppliers in line with company and regulatory requirements.
  • Resolve delivery, invoice, and quality discrepancies.
Required Skills & Experience
  • Proven experience in aviation or aerospace procurement/supply chain.
  • Strong knowledge of aircraft parts, ATA chapters, and MRO operations.
  • Familiarity with aviation regulations (EASA Part 145, FAA).
  • Excellent negotiation and communication skills.
  • Proficiency in procurement software and ERP systems (Quantum, SAP, AMOS).
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ities under pressure.
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ills.
